Gov. Pritzker sounds alarm on SNAP cuts during East St. Louis visit
EAST ST. LOUIS, Ill. - Illinois Gov. J.B. Pritzker made a stop in East St. Louis on Tuesday to discuss the impacts federal cuts could have on food assistance. The governor met with leaders of multiple Metro East organizations at the Leslie Bates Senior Circle Cafe.
